About the Role

The Head of Fundraising will lead a multi-disciplinary fundraising team comprised of established and new members responsible for delivering the current fundraising strategy and activity plan to meet and, where possible, exceed the income generation targets.

Using your experience of managing and delivering diverse fundraising strategies and plans you will also be required to work closely with the senior leadership team to develop and deliver the organisation’s five-year fundraising strategy for 2022-2027 to meet the charitable aims.

About You

We are looking for an inspirational and forward thinking leader who can set the vision for a multi-disciplinary fundraising team to develop robust fundraising plans in order to support survivor-led services and ensure the charity can continue its vital work. You will have experience of a range of fundraising disciplines with a strong track record of securing funds from small and large trusts, communities, corporates, major donors and individuals.

Experience of managing a team to deliver against fundraising targets, monitoring and evaluating outputs and working across a range of fundraising areas are essential. The successful candidate will be passionate about the charity’s work and able to articulate its values with confidence and professionalism to stakeholders and funders. About the Organisation

The charity is working towards a world without slavery. They provide safe houses and support in the community for survivors of trafficking and modern slavery and also run the Modern Slavery & Exploitation Helpline and work with individuals, communities, business, governments, other charities and statutory agencies to stamp out slavery for good.
